如何高效利用多核CPU运行Excel?如何优化处理大量数据?
作者:佚名|分类:EXCEL|浏览:62|发布时间:2025-04-15 10:22:37
如何高效利用多核CPU运行Excel?如何优化处理大量数据?
一、引言
随着计算机技术的不断发展,多核CPU已经成为了主流。在处理大量数据时,如何高效利用多核CPU运行Excel,成为了许多用户关心的问题。本文将详细讲解如何高效利用多核CPU运行Excel,以及如何优化处理大量数据。
二、如何高效利用多核CPU运行Excel
1. 使用Excel的多线程功能
Excel 2013及以上版本支持多线程功能,可以充分利用多核CPU的优势。在处理大量数据时,可以通过以下步骤开启多线程功能:
(1)打开Excel,点击“文件”菜单,选择“选项”。
(2)在“Excel选项”对话框中,切换到“高级”选项卡。
(3)在“计算选项”区域,勾选“多线程计算”复选框。
(4)点击“确定”按钮,关闭对话框。
2. 使用Excel的“并行计算”功能
Excel的“并行计算”功能可以充分利用多核CPU,提高数据处理速度。以下是如何使用“并行计算”功能的步骤:
(1)打开Excel,点击“文件”菜单,选择“选项”。
(2)在“Excel选项”对话框中,切换到“计算”选项卡。
(3)在“计算选项”区域,勾选“启用并行计算”复选框。
(4)点击“设置”按钮,进入“并行计算参数”设置界面。
(5)在“并行计算参数”设置界面中,设置并行计算的核心数,建议设置为CPU核心数减去1。
(6)点击“确定”按钮,关闭对话框。
三、如何优化处理大量数据
1. 使用合适的数据格式
在处理大量数据时,选择合适的数据格式可以降低数据处理的难度。以下是一些常用的数据格式:
(1)文本格式:适用于存储字符串类型的数据。
(2)数值格式:适用于存储数字类型的数据。
(3)日期格式:适用于存储日期类型的数据。
2. 使用数据透视表
数据透视表是一种强大的数据分析工具,可以方便地对大量数据进行汇总、筛选和分析。以下是如何使用数据透视表的步骤:
(1)选中需要分析的数据区域。
(2)点击“插入”菜单,选择“数据透视表”。
(3)在“创建数据透视表”对话框中,选择放置数据透视表的位置。
(4)在数据透视表字段列表中,将需要分析的字段拖拽到相应的行、列、值等区域。
3. 使用VBA脚本
VBA(Visual Basic for Applications)是一种强大的编程语言,可以实现对Excel的自动化操作。以下是如何使用VBA脚本优化处理大量数据的步骤:
(1)打开Excel,按下“Alt + F11”键,进入VBA编辑器。
(2)在VBA编辑器中,插入一个新的模块。
(3)在模块中编写VBA代码,实现对大量数据的处理。
四、相关问答
1. 问题:多核CPU在运行Excel时,如何设置核心数?
答案:在Excel选项中,切换到“计算”选项卡,勾选“启用并行计算”复选框,点击“设置”按钮,进入“并行计算参数”设置界面,设置并行计算的核心数。
2. 问题:如何使用数据透视表分析大量数据?
答案:选中需要分析的数据区域,点击“插入”菜单,选择“数据透视表”,在“创建数据透视表”对话框中,选择放置数据透视表的位置,将需要分析的字段拖拽到相应的行、列、值等区域。
3. 问题:如何使用VBA脚本优化处理大量数据?
答案:打开Excel,按下“Alt + F11”键,进入VBA编辑器,插入一个新的模块,在模块中编写VBA代码,实现对大量数据的处理。
总结
本文详细讲解了如何高效利用多核CPU运行Excel,以及如何优化处理大量数据。通过使用Excel的多线程功能、并行计算功能,以及合适的数据格式、数据透视表和VBA脚本,可以显著提高数据处理速度,提高工作效率。希望本文对您有所帮助。